SenseTime to Spin Off Healthcare Division, Harnessing Advanced AI for Medical Innovation

TLDR: Hong Kong-listed AI giant SenseTime is set to spin off its healthcare platform into a new, independent entity. This strategic move aims to leverage the transformative power of advanced Large Language Models (LLMs) and generative AI in the medical sector. The new company has already secured pre-A round funding and will focus on AI-enabled smart hospital solutions, enhancing diagnostics, treatment, and patient services.

SenseTime, a prominent Hong Kong-listed artificial intelligence company, has announced its plans to spin off its healthcare platform, SenseTime Healthcare, into a new, independent entity. This strategic decision is driven by the rapid advancements in Large Language Models (LLMs) and generative AI, which are profoundly transforming the medical field.

The newly formed healthcare company aims to capitalize on these technological shifts by focusing on innovative AI-enabled smart hospital solutions. These solutions encompass a wide range of services, including diagnostic and treatment assistance, AI-powered patient services, and comprehensive AI medical and hospital group services. Professor Li Hongsheng, the chief scientist for medical foundation models at SenseTime Healthcare, highlighted the integrated nature of their offerings. “The solution is like an AI-enabled medical journey for patients, beginning from the moment they make an appointment,” Li explained. He further elaborated, “For instance, patients can articulate their symptoms using the language model, which then directs them to the most appropriate department.” The platform is also designed to provide continuous care, extending to post-discharge follow-up services.

SenseTime’s healthcare solution integrates sophisticated AI algorithms with advanced image post-processing technology. This combination is engineered to support clinical departments and hospitals throughout the entire patient journey, from initial diagnosis and treatment to recovery. Professor Li emphasized the collaborative role of AI and human expertise, stating, “While the AI generates automatic results, these will still be verified by human doctors, as we aim to enhance their efficiency throughout the process.”

To fuel the growth of this new venture, SenseTime is actively seeking external investments. Professor Li confirmed, “We are seeking new investments. We have successfully completed a pre-A funding round.” This move underscores SenseTime’s commitment to generative AI as a core business and a significant growth engine. The company reported a remarkable 256% growth in its generative AI segment during the first half of 2024, contributing to 60% of its total revenue.
